Transaction 588403e83afd93a19dcf7d9949137da71649de3a22605d3835d562a8ada5553d

1 Input
2 Outputs
  • 588403e83afd93a19dcf7d9949137da71649de3a22605d3835d562a8ada5553d:0
  • value  5000000
    address  1Af6WnXWYaUXFihbtFgK1wZ8cu7kxCfkHj
  • 588403e83afd93a19dcf7d9949137da71649de3a22605d3835d562a8ada5553d:1
  • value  14778850
    address  14imhMSJtLxj4rNg5Pm4xsfEgtmcWoF6p5